KANSAS CITY, Mo. — Authorities are asking for the public’s help in finding a girl with autism who did not get on her school bus on Thursday afternoon.
Isabella Davies was last seen on Thursday afternoon at University Academy at 68th and Holmes. She is described as bi-racial, 5’4″, 110 pounds with black curly hair and dark brown eyes.
She was wearing a navy short sleeve collared shirt, khaki pants, white tennis shoes and a metallic grey puffy winter coat with fur on the hood. She also had a pink and navy plaid backpack.
If you have any information about her whereabouts, call 9-1-1 or Kansas City Missouri Police.
